A medical devices company in the United Kingdom seeks a Senior R&D Manager to lead projects focused on novel drug delivery systems, specifically infusion pumps. This role will involve both strategic leadership and hands-on design work within a multidisciplinary team.
The ideal candidate should have strong mechanical engineering fundamentals, experience with drug delivery systems, and familiarity with the complete design cycle.
The company offers a competitive salary, bonuses, and a supportive work environment fostering innovation.
